Have you tried deleting your #~/.kde

You will lose ALL of your kde settings (back up your address book if you use 
kmail), and the directory will be re-created at the next log-on.  This can 
fix a messed-up-beyond-all-repair KDE, and it looks as though you have a 
serious KDE problem.  If I were you, I would create a new user and log-in to 
KDE as that user first, to see if the problem clears up.  If the problem 
persists, ignore all of the above and search for another solution.
